Travelling from the West
Greetings all
Just a quick note to let people coming from the West know you don,t need to go all the way to Iron Knob turnoff you can go in from Wirrula,Wudinna,or Kimba the road is the same if not better(less traffic) than the Iron Knob road, get hold of a good road map i think i went from Wudinna 06, just keep an eye out for the turnoff to the Lake as it will be on your left on a corner and easy to miss, i missed it!!see you there, can,t wait
